Charles Schwab is hiring a Director, Software Development & Engineering to play a critical leadership role in transforming the Portfolio Management Technology (PMT) organization as part of our **Broker-Dealer Modernization (BDM)**journey. This is not a traditional engineering leadership role, this leader is expected to fundamentally reset how software is built-moving the organization from a legacy, human-heavy SDLC to a GenAI- and agentic-AI-driven development model. The industry, tooling, and economics of software development have changed. This role need to ensure PMT does not fall behind-and instead becomes a model for AI-driven engineering at Schwab.
